TECHNICAL BULLETIN # 1337 12-4-95 = Ascentia 910N Not Recognizing The IBM PCMCIA Token Ring Adapter When Using With Lan Server Requester Under OS/2 Warp PROBLEM The PCMCIA configuration utility recognizes an IBM PCMCIA Token Ring adapter, when using the adapter with a fresh install of the Lan Requester 4.0, under OS/2 Warp, on an Ascentia 910N system. However, the configuration utility shows the card "not ready" and the unit is unable to make a connection to the network. CAUSE Lan Server Requester's install program does not configure the IBM PCMCIA Token Ring card properly. SOLUTION After the installation of the Lan Server Requester is completed, follow the steps below: 1. Start the MPTS configuration program by clicking on the MPTS icon in the Desktop folder. Click on the "configure" button. 2. When the "configure" box pops up, click on the "configure" button. 3. In the "LAP Configuration" box, click on "edit". 4. The next screen will display "Parameters for IBM PCMCIA Token-Ring Network adapter". The Lan Server Requester install program does not configure "Shared RAM Address" and Memory mapped I/O address" automatically. Use your mouse or arrow keys to select the parameter to edit these fields to D400 and D800 respectively. 5. Click on OK, update the CONFIG.SYS file, and exit. 6. Shut down the system and restart. Upon reboot, the PCMCIA configuration utility will recognize the IBM card and the Card Status field will show OK. SYSTEMS AFFECTED AST PART NUMBER AND DESCRIPTION 501592-XXX Ascentia 910N 4/50 Color-10 501590-XXX Ascentia 910N 4/75 Color-10 501589-XXX Ascentia 910N 4/75 ColorPlus-10
